Mounting
The O4 Lite Air Unit is designed for micro-sized FPV drones, resembling tinywhoop and ultralight quads. Since these small drones sometimes use a flight controller with a 25.5×25.5mm mounting sample, it’s doable to mount the O4 AU straight on prime as a part of a single stack.
Many trendy frames have devoted areas within the rear for mounting the VTX, however this will not all the time work for the O4 Lite resulting from its quick digital camera cable (solely 5cm lengthy).
The true problem is mounting the digital camera resulting from its unconventional mounting system. If in case you have entry to a 3D printer, you possibly can design a customized mount on your current body. Disconnecting Digital camera and Antenna
It’s doable to disconnect the digital camera from the transmission module, however the coaxial cable/connectors are glued in place. Until you may reapply the glue after reconnection, I don’t suggest disconnecting them. Eradicating or changing the antenna is simple although.
Powering the O4 Lite
The O4 Air Unit (Lite) could be powered straight from a 1S, 2S, or 3S LiPo battery (3.7–13.2V). Nevertheless, the Air Unit could develop into unreliable and even shut down when the voltage drops under 3.7V. Subsequently, it’s not beneficial to energy the O4 Air Unit straight from a 1S LiPo. As an alternative, energy it from a secure 5V or 9V BEC on the flight controller, which additionally offers extra safety towards voltage spikes.
Energy necessities:
- Max energy consumption: ~6W
- Present draw at 700mW: 5V 1.2A or 9V 0.67A
- Really helpful BEC: Minimal 5V 2A BEC or 9V 1A BEC (If in case you have different power-hungry units, think about using a higher-rated BEC)
Flight Controller Connection
The DJI O4 Lite Air Unit makes use of the similar 6-pin connector and pinout because the O3 and O4 Professional, making it plug-and-play with any flight controller designed for current DJI Air Models. Nevertheless, you need to all the time double-check the wiring upon connection to keep away from any surprises.
Pinout of the 6-pin connector:
- VCC: Energy provide
- GND: Floor
- RX/TX: Required for OSD and telemetry (e.g., displaying battery voltage and arming detection)
- GND and SBUS: For DJI Distant Controller (non-obligatory)
In contrast to the O4 Professional, the O4 Lite doesn’t have solder pads. If you wish to solder it on to the flight controller, you’ll need to lower off the connector from the cable and strip the wires.
In case you are not utilizing a DJI Distant to regulate the drone, and are as a substitute utilizing your individual radio receiver, it’s beneficial to take away the SBUS wire (DJI HDL) from the connector. This may stop potential conflicts. Use a pointy software, resembling a pin or needle, to barely raise the tab within the connector and pull the wire out. On this case you might also take away the extra floor wire (brown).
Activation
As soon as the O4 Lite is related to the flight controller (FC), it’s time to activate it. If the Air Unit was beforehand activated, this step shouldn’t be required.
Professional Tip: that the O4 Air Unit should be powered by a battery or a accurately rated energy provide throughout activation. In contrast to the O3, it can’t be activated utilizing simply the USB-C cable. Though the USB-C cable shouldn’t be included, any USB-C knowledge cable will work.
Obtain DJI Assistant 2 (Shopper Drone Sequence): https://www.dji.com/nl/downloads/softwares/dji-assistant-2-consumer-drones-series.
If in case you have put in it, it’s nonetheless a good suggestion to obtain and re-install the newest model.
Professional Tip: activation CANNOT be finished within the DJI Fly App.
Firmware Replace
Whereas related to DJI Assistant 2, test if new firmware is out there on your O4.
Professional Tip: For firmware updates, you may safely unplug the battery through the course of to keep away from heating.

Unlock FCC Mode
In case your Goggles 3 are shipped with CE mode (to adjust to European laws), they are going to be restricted by way of output energy (solely 25mW) and channels. There might be just one obtainable channel within the 40MHz mode and three obtainable channels within the 20MHz mode.
In FCC mode, you need to have the utmost 1200mW output energy choice, and there needs to be 7 obtainable channels within the 20MHz mode, and three obtainable channels within the 40MHz and 60MHz mode.
For goggles in CE mode, it’s doable to carry out the “FCC hack” to unlock increased output energy (extra vary and sign penetration) and extra channels (permits extra pilots within the air on the similar time), however solely do that if it’s authorized the place you fly.
To change to FCC mode, merely get the file “ham_cfg_support”, unzip it to the foundation listing of the SD card and put it within the goggles, energy on goggles, that’s it.
Obtain file right here: https://drive.google.com/file/d/1ug2U_i5kdrKQQ2I17NLJBXm2tKQeNj5Q/view?usp=share_link
To test in case you are in FCC mode, go to Settings => Transmission => Channel Mode, change to Handbook, underneath 40MHz or 60MHz bandwidth, you need to see 3 channels obtainable in FCC mode. If it can solely present 1 channel there, you might be in CE mode.
As soon as FCC mode is unlocked, you gained’t need to do it once more. You’ll be able to return to CE mode by manufacturing facility reset the goggles (within the menu Settings => About).
Setup OSD in Betaflight
The DJI O4 Air Unit totally helps the Betaflight OSD, together with the Betaflight OSD menu and all obtainable OSD components.
Go to the Presets tab, and seek for “dji”, the “FPV.WTF MSP-OSD” preset ought to pop up. In choices, choose the UART you’ve got related to the O4 Lite Air Unit.
To allow HD OSD, go to the settings menu within the goggles, Settings > Show > Canvas Mode, and choose HD OSD.
This lets you show the OSD with smaller fonts and drag OSD components all the way in which to the sides of the display. If you choose Regular Mode, the font will seem a lot bigger.
Lastly, go to the OSD tab in Betaflight Configurator. Underneath Video Format, guarantee HD is chosen.
Setup DJI Distant Controller
For those who’re utilizing a third-party radio hyperlink, you may skip this part.
Utilizing DJI’s distant controller eliminates the necessity to wire a separate radio receiver to the flight controller, because the DJI O4 Air Unit additionally serves as an RC hyperlink. This simplifies the setup course of. Nevertheless, there are a number of downsides to think about:
- Fundamental performance: DJI’s distant controllers lack the superior options and management precision supplied by extra subtle techniques like ExpressLRS.
- Failsafe dependency: Because the video and radio indicators share the identical hyperlink, shedding the video sign additionally ends in a failsafe, which isn’t the case with superior RC hyperlinks like ExpressLRS that sometimes outperform video hyperlinks considerably.

Movies Recording
The O4 Air Unit has 23GB of onboard reminiscence for recording flight footage. Relying on the decision you choose, it could possibly retailer roughly 30 to 45 minutes of recordings. Sadly, it doesn’t assist micro SD playing cards, so be certain that to offload footage repeatedly; in any other case, the unit would possibly cease recording till you unencumber reminiscence.
You’ll be able to begin recording by utilizing the Document button within the goggles’ prime menu. Alternatively, you may configure the O4 Air Unit to start out recording mechanically whenever you arm the quad within the system menu. Navigate to Settings → Digital camera → Superior Digital camera Settings to allow this selection, which many pilots discover extra handy.

Video Stabilization
Video stabilization helps clean out flight footage by lowering shakiness and vibrations. The O4 Air Unit helps two stabilization strategies: RockSteady and Gyroflow.
- RockSteady is built-in and could be enabled within the goggles’ menu. It stabilizes footage mechanically throughout recording, providing first rate outcomes with minimal effort. To allow RockSteady, set Recording Stabilization to ON.
- Gyroflow is an open-source, software-based stabilization software that gives extra flexibility. It means that you can fine-tune stabilization settings in post-processing. With Gyroflow, the uncooked footage stays unstabilized, supplying you with full management over how a lot stabilization to use. To make use of Gyroflow, set Recording Stabilization to OFF.
For greatest outcomes with Gyroflow, use the next settings:
- Facet Ratio: 4:3
- Digital camera FOV: Huge
- Recording Stabilization: OFF

Find out how to Keep away from Jello and Vibration
Much like the O3, the O4 digital camera is extremely delicate to vibrations, making it essential to isolate the digital camera from vibration sources or get rid of vibrations altogether.
Keep away from utilizing 24kHz PWM frequency in your ESC settings, as decrease PWM frequencies can improve vibrations and noise. As an alternative, use a increased frequency, resembling 48kHz, for optimum efficiency.
Mounting the O4 digital camera straight on carbon fiber or CNC aluminum is not beneficial, as vibrations can switch straight from the motors to the digital camera, inflicting jello in your footage. As an alternative, use a mushy mounting materials that gives vibration dampening. Many new frames embrace silicone or rubber inserts/spacers particularly designed for mounting the O4 FPV cameras, serving to to cut back vibrations considerably.

Race Mode
Race Mode is a characteristic designed particularly for FPV racing, obtainable solely on the DJI Goggles 3 and N3, however not on the Goggles 2 and Integra resulting from {hardware} limitations. It optimizes the system for low-latency efficiency and minimizes interference in race environments by aligning its channel frequencies to Race band. Right here’s what Race Mode affords:
- Lowest Latency: Race Mode forces the system into 100fps with a 20MHz bandwidth, reaching latency as little as 20ms.
- Channel Alignment: Channels align with customary race band frequencies, making it extra appropriate with different FPV techniques.
- Cleaner Sign: The telemetry hyperlink now operates on the identical static frequency because the video sign, lowering interference with different pilots. When the Air Unit is off, the goggles cease transmitting altogether, permitting pilots to stroll round with out affecting others.
- Commerce-offs: Narrower bandwidth and decrease energy output cut back vary and penetration, making it unsuitable for freestyle, cinematic, or long-range flying. Nevertheless, these limitations are acceptable for racing, which generally happens in open fields.
Warning: Keep away from powering in your Air Unit whereas others are within the air, because it momentarily sweeps throughout the band, probably inflicting interference for many who are nonetheless within the air. For all different varieties of flying, regular mode affords higher RF efficiency.
Transmission Energy Superb Tune
This characteristic means that you can fine-tune the output energy of your VTX by ±1mW to ±7mW to make sure compliance with racing occasion laws. For many customers, this setting isn’t obligatory except you’re attending a regulated racing occasion the place exact energy ranges are required.
Spectator Mode
The Spectator Mode helps you to watch different pilots flying with the O4 Air Unit, nevertheless it comes with compatibility limitations:
- Goggles 3 and N3 customers can solely spectate different pilots utilizing G3 and N3.
- Goggles 2 and Integra can solely spectate different pilots utilizing G2 and Integra.
Spectator Mode doesn’t work throughout these two generations, so make sure you’re utilizing the identical technology goggles because the pilot you need to spectate.
